eXensys 4.1 Launched
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
eXensys 4.1, the latest software of Exensys, is incorporated with functions to enhance and optimize the business processes of companies and align them to their strategic goals resulting in faster decision-making and an agility to survive rapid market changes. It is the only Indian product in the enterprise space having representation in all verticals and is also available in seven global languages – French, Russian, Arabic, Persian, Chinese, Greek and English. It transforms complex business data into dynamic actionable information for faster decision-making owing to availability of right information at the right time and at the right place. It provides a single view of data across an enterprise. eXensys 4.1 delivers information without undergoing complex business process changes and all the challenges associated with it. It is an excellent Human Factor Interface product, which can be used by a novice as well. eXensys 4.0 is the result of extensive research and development carried out at the Exensys Development Center in Kondapur, Hyderabad.

Exensys will Launch “On Device Portal” (ODP)
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
Exensys will Launch “On Device Portal” (ODP) for global customers.
Mobile data services are enjoying rapid user growth and increasingly rich multimedia contents. With the increasing computing power of mobile devices, and increasing intertwining of mobile Internet with vast Internet contents and Internet ecosystem, Fixed-Mobile Convergence has become a major trend.
|
|
|
| The term "On Device Portal" (ODP) is defined to be a "thin client" software providing a Graphical User Interface (GUI) to improve the presentation of content on mobile devices and addressing the customer needs for easy access to rich content, without latency, easier navigation and "not-always-on" connectivity. |
| ODP is designed as an end-to-end portal solution to provide the user with seamless experience across multiple access channels, focusing on mobile Internet channels such as on-device widgets, WAP, messaging clients, etc., but complemented by a rich Web portal. Fundamentally, it is designed from the beginning to deliver across channels. |
| ODP is designed over an open Widget architecture, so that it can source both provider-specific media contents and open Internet contents, using well accepted Internet standards such as RSS/OPML, HTML/XML, most MIME contents, packaged contents, over HTTP/SOAP/FTP. This Widget architecture also serves as the foundation for On Device Portal to deliver contents to a variety of access channels and delivers specific contents such as search/promotion/advertisements across access channels in a flexible way. |
| Specifically, ODP offers a combination of one or more of the following three applications: |
  |
Offline Portal: A portal application that handles content in a way that the user perceives as always-on, instantly accessible experience. |
  |
Store-front: A client-server application mimicking the experience of walking past shop fronts. |
  |
Home-screen replacement: A client application that replaces the home (idle) screen of the handset, so that it constitutes the origin of every user journey. |
|
| ODP has now extended beyond embedded content consumption, home-screen and discovery into search, personalization, back-up, lifecycle management and advertising. Proprietary solutions (non-Java) and handset vendor-specific solutions to extend handset coverage have been developed by vendors. |
